What’s Really Happening With the ACET?
First, let’s clear things up. The NCUA still officially supports the automated cybersecurity evaluation toolbox (ACET), but the Cybersecurity Assessment Tool (CAT) it was built on was sunset at the end of August 2025. So why the change? Simply put, the ACET couldn’t keep up. When it was introduced in 2015, it served a purpose, but it quickly became an "enormous beast" that was difficult to untangle.
